GithubHelp home page GithubHelp logo

wangye1973 / heytap Goto Github PK

View Code? Open in Web Editor NEW

This project forked from gys619/heytap

0.0 0.0 0.0 401 KB

基于Python爬虫的欢太商城自动任务脚本

License: GNU General Public License v3.0

Python 100.00%

heytap's Introduction

HeyTap

适配青龙面板

  • 点击前往QL_HeyTap
  • 注意:青龙版欢太脚本配信模块暂未完成

免责声明

  • 本仓库发布的HeyTap项目中涉及的任何脚本,仅用于测试和学习研究,禁止用于商业用途,不能保证其合法性,准确性,完整性和有效性,请根据情况自行判断.

  • 所有使用者在使用HeyTap项目的任何部分时,需先遵守法律法规。对于一切使用不当所造成的后果,需自行承担.对任何脚本问题概不负责,包括但不限于由任何脚本错误导致的任何损失或损害.

  • 如果任何单位或个人认为该项目可能涉嫌侵犯其权利,则应及时通知并提供身份证明,所有权证明,我们将在收到认证文件后删除相关文件.

  • 任何以任何方式查看此项目的人或直接或间接使用该HeyTap项目的任何脚本的使用者都应仔细阅读此声明。本人保留随时更改或补充此免责声明的权利。一旦使用并复制了任何相关脚本或HeyTap项目的规则,则视为您已接受此免责声明.

您必须在下载后的24小时内从计算机或手机中完全删除以上内容.

您使用或者复制了本仓库且本人制作的任何脚本,则视为已接受此声明,请仔细阅读

环境

Python3 >= 3.6.8

已实现功能

  • 每日签到
  • 每日浏览商品任务
  • 每日分享商品任务
  • 每日点推送任务(已下架)
  • 赚积分活动
  • 天天积分翻倍(默认注释,基本抽不到)
  • 天天领现金任务列表(可能黑号)
  • 天天领现金定时红包(可能黑号)
  • 早睡打卡
  • 积分大作战
  • 发信功能(太懒了,只实现一个)

文件说明

│  HeyTap.py         # 欢太商城任务中心
│  timingCash.py     # 欢太定时红包,建议配合Linux定时系统Crontab
│  dailyCash.py      # 每日现金任务
│  CheckInEarly.py   # 欢太商城,早睡报名或打卡,建议配合Linux定时系统Crontab
│  PointsBattle.py   # 积分大作战
│  config.py         # 账号信息
│  formatCK.py       # 格式化CK,用于转换CK(省的手动提取)
│  README.md         # 说明文档

Windows

Linux

yum install python3 -y

yum install git -y

git clone https://ghproxy.com/https://github.com/Mashiro2000/HeyTap.git   # 国内git较慢,故添加代理前缀

cd HeyTap

vi config.py

配置信息

编辑 config.py

管理员配置

admin = {
    "pushGroup" :{
        "pushToken": "",                            # Push Plus Token
        "pushTopic": ""                             # Push Plus群组编码
    },
    "mask":['', '']                                 # 屏蔽某些脚本的通知功能,如:['HeyTap','dailyCash']
}

用户信息

accounts = [
    {
        'user' : 'A',                                      # 备注(为了区分账号,包括未登录状态下)
        'CK' : 'TOKENSID=TOKEN_xxxx;app_param=xxx;',       # 用户环境变量 Cookie,直接全部粘贴也可以
        'UA' : 'UA1'                                       # 用户环境变量 User-Agent
    },
    {
        'user' : 'B',                                      # 备注(为了区分账号,包括未登录状态下)
        'CK' : 'TOKENSID=TOKEN_xxxx;app_param=xxx;',       # 用户环境变量 Cookie,直接全部粘贴也可以
        'UA' : 'UA2'                                       # 用户环境变量 User-Agent
    },
]

变量值

  • 结果测试欢太所需CK为: TOKENSIDapp_param
  • 可通过formatCK.py进行对CK进行格式化处理

环境变量

  • CK和UA信息需自行抓包,欢太商城 -> 我的 -> 任务中心 -> 领券中心
  • 抓包地址:https://store.oppo.com/cn/oapi/users/web/checkPeople/isNewPeople

其它帮助

crontab 帮助文档

heytap's People

Contributors

mashiro2000 av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.